기계 번역으로 제공되는 번역입니다. 제공된 번역과 원본 영어의 내용이 상충하는 경우에는 영어 버전이 우선합니다.
MediaTailor SSAI를 수익화된 선형 채널의 채널 어셈블리와 통합
이 주제에서는 AWS Elemental MediaTailor 서버 측 광고 삽입을 채널 어셈블리 및 콘텐츠 전송 네트워크(CDN) 통합과 결합하는 방법을 설명합니다. 이 통합을 통해 다음을 수행할 수 있습니다.
-
맞춤형 광고를 통해 수익화된 선형 채널 생성
-
동일한 콘텐츠를 시청하는 다른 시청자에게 대상 광고를 제공합니다.
-
방송 품질 시청 경험 유지
SSAI를 채널 어셈블리와 결합할 때의 이점
SSAI를 채널 어셈블리와 통합하면 다음과 같은 몇 가지 주요 이점이 있습니다.
- 선형 채널의 수익화
-
맞춤형 광고를 선형 채널에 삽입하여 콘텐츠 라이브러리에서 수익을 창출합니다. 단일 선형 스트림 내에서 라이브 콘텐츠와 VOD 콘텐츠를 모두 수익화할 수 있습니다.
- 맞춤형 광고
-
동일한 채널 콘텐츠를 시청하는 다양한 시청자에게 다양한 광고를 제공합니다. 이 목표 접근 방식은 기존 방송 광고에 비해 광고 관련성과 잠재적 수익을 높입니다.
- 간소화된 광고 시간 관리
-
SCTE-35 마커로 콘텐츠를 조건화할 필요 없이 채널 어셈블리 프로그램에서 광고 중단점을 정의합니다. 이렇게 하면 콘텐츠의 자연스러운 중단점에 광고를 더 쉽게 삽입할 수 있습니다.
- 방송 품질 경험
-
MediaTailor는 콘텐츠와 광고 간의 원활한 전환을 통해 고품질 시청 환경을 유지합니다. 서버 측 광고 삽입은 다음과 같은 많은 일반적인 문제를 제거합니다.
-
광고 전환 중 버퍼링
-
수익화를 방지하는 광고 차단기
-
일관되지 않은 재생 품질
-
- 확장 가능한 전송
-
이 통합을 CDN과 결합하면 성능 또는 개인화 기능의 저하 없이 수백만 명의 동시 뷰어로 확장할 수 있습니다.
아키텍처 개요
SSAI를 채널 어셈블리와 결합하기 위한 아키텍처에는 일반적으로 다음과 같은 구성 요소가 포함됩니다.
-
채널 어셈블리: VOD 및 라이브 콘텐츠에서 선형 채널을 생성하고 생성된 매니페스트에 광고 마커를 생성하는 슬레이트 콘텐츠를 삽입합니다.
-
광고 삽입: 광고 중단점을 인식하고 매니페스트에서 개인화된 광고 세그먼트를 가리키URLs을 삽입합니다.
-
광고 결정 서버(ADS): 각 뷰어에 삽입할 광고를 결정합니다.
-
콘텐츠 전송 네트워크(CDN): 어셈블된 콘텐츠와 광고 세그먼트를 최종 사용자에게 전달합니다.
-
오리진 서버: VOD 및 라이브 콘텐츠 세그먼트를 저장합니다.
이 아키텍처에서,
-
채널 어셈블리는 VOD 및 라이브 콘텐츠에서 선형 채널을 생성하고 생성된 매니페스트에 광고 마커를 생성하는 슬레이트 콘텐츠를 삽입합니다.
-
최종 사용자가 채널을 요청하면 광고 삽입은 선형 채널에 삽입된 광고 시간을 인식합니다.
-
광고 삽입은 ADS를 호출하여 광고 목록을 수신하고, 트랜스코딩하고, 트랜스코딩된 광고 세그먼트를 가리키URLs을 개인화된 매니페스트에 삽입합니다.
-
CDN은 개인화된 스트림을 최종 사용자에게 전달합니다.
다음 다이어그램은이 워크플로를 보여줍니다.

통합 설정
채널 어셈블리를 사용하여 SSAI를 설정하려면:
-
최종 사용자의 매니페스트 요청을 수락하고 AWS Elemental MediaTailor 광고 삽입에 전달하도록 엣지 CDN을 구성합니다.
-
MediaTailor 광고 삽입을 설정하여 오리진 CDN에 요청을 전달합니다.
-
MediaTailor 채널 어셈블리에 요청을 전달하도록 오리진 CDN을 구성합니다.
-
현재 일정에 따라 동적 매니페스트를 생성하도록 MediaTailor 채널 어셈블리를 설정합니다.
-
어셈블된 매니페스트를 MediaTailor 광고 삽입에 전달하도록 오리진 CDN을 구성합니다.
-
MediaTailor 광고 삽입을 설정하여 광고 중단 시점에 광고 결정 서버에 광고 결정을 요청합니다.
-
광고 마커(채널 어셈블리)를 대상 광고 세그먼트(ADS)를 가리키는 URLs로 대체하여 매니페스트를 개인화하도록 MediaTailor 광고 삽입을 구성합니다.
-
최종 사용자에게 개인화된 매니페스트를 제공하도록 엣지 CDN을 설정합니다.
-
콘텐츠 및 광고 세그먼트 요청을 효율적으로 처리하도록 CDN 아키텍처를 구성합니다.
채널 어셈블리의 광고 시간 정의
채널 어셈블리에서 프로그램을 생성할 때 다음과 같은 여러 가지 방법으로 광고 시간을 정의할 수 있습니다.
- 프로그램 전환
-
채널 일정의 프로그램 간에 광고를 삽입합니다. 이는 가장 간단한 접근 방식이며 광고가 프로그램 콘텐츠를 중단하지 않도록 합니다.
- SCTE-35 마커
-
VOD 콘텐츠에 SCTE-35 마커가 포함된 경우 채널 어셈블리는 이러한 마커를 보존할 수 있으며 광고 삽입은 이를 광고 중단점으로 사용할 수 있습니다.
- 시간 기반 삽입
-
프로그램 내 특정 시점에 광고 시간을 정의합니다. 이렇게 하면 콘텐츠의 자연스러운 중단점에 광고를 삽입할 수 있습니다.
광고 시간을 사용하여 프로그램을 생성하는 방법에 대한 자세한 내용은 프로그램 작업을 참조하세요.
CDN 캐싱 고려 사항
채널 어셈블리와 SSAI를 CDN과 결합할 때 최적의 성능을 얻으려면:
-
채널 어셈블리와 SSAI 요청을 구분하는 캐시 동작 구성
-
의 권장 사항에 따라 매니페스트 및 세그먼트에 적절한 TTL 값을 설정합니다. 1단계: 최적의 광고 전송을 위해 CDN 캐싱 구성
-
채널 어셈블리, 광고 삽입 및 CDN 오리진 간에 적절한 라우팅 보장
-
채널 어셈블리 및 광고 삽입 구성 요소 모두에 대한 성능 지표 모니터링
콘텐츠 유형 | TTL | 캐시 키 요소 |
---|---|---|
채널 어셈블리 매니페스트 | 0초 | URL 경로 + 쿼리 파라미터 |
SSAI 개인화된 매니페스트 | 0초 | URL 경로 + 모든 쿼리 파라미터 |
콘텐츠 세그먼트 | 24시간 이상 | URL 경로만 |
광고 세그먼트 | 24시간 이상 | URL 경로만 |
통합 솔루션 모니터링
통합 솔루션이 최적으로 작동하는지 확인하려면 다음 주요 지표를 모니터링하세요.
- 채널 어셈블리 지표
-
매니페스트 생성 시간, 프로그램 전환 및 채널 어셈블리 프로세스의 오류를 모니터링합니다.
- 광고 삽입 지표
-
광고 채우기 속도, 광고 결정 서버 응답 시간 및 광고 삽입 오류를 추적합니다.
- CDN 지표
-
콘텐츠 및 광고 세그먼트 모두에 대한 캐시 적중률, 오리진 요청 볼륨 및 응답 지연 시간을 모니터링합니다.
- 최종 사용자 경험 지표
-
특히 광고 전환 중에 재버퍼링 이벤트, 시작 시간 및 최종 사용자 참여를 추적합니다.
모니터링에 대한 자세한 내용은 CDN 및 MediaTailor 통합에 대한 작업 모니터링 및 섹션을 참조하세요MediaTailor 채널 어셈블리 CDN 작업 모니터링.
일반적인 문제 해결
통합 솔루션 관련 문제를 해결할 때는 다음과 같은 일반적인 문제를 고려하세요.
- 광고 중단 동기화 문제
-
광고가 예상 중단점에 나타나지 않는 경우 채널 어셈블리 프로그램의 광고 중단 정의가 올바르게 구성되었는지, 광고 삽입이 이러한 중단점을 제대로 식별하는지 확인합니다.
- 매니페스트 전송 오류
-
최종 사용자에게 재생 문제가 발생하는 경우 CDN이 채널 어셈블리와 광고 삽입 간에 매니페스트 요청을 올바르게 전달하고 캐시 설정이 이러한 매니페스트의 동적 특성에 적합한지 확인합니다.
- 세그먼트 라우팅 문제
-
콘텐츠 또는 광고 세그먼트가 로드되지 않는 경우 CDN이 세그먼트 요청을 적절한 오리진으로 올바르게 라우팅하고 매니페스트의 세그먼트 URLs의 형식이 올바른지 확인합니다.
- 성능 저하
-
최종 사용자가 버퍼링 또는 지연 시간이 긴 경우 CDN 캐시 적중률 및 오리진 요청 볼륨을 확인하여 전송 파이프라인의 잠재적 병목 현상을 식별합니다.
자세한 문제 해결 지침은 섹션을 참조하세요중단 없는 광고 전송을 위해 CDNs 사용한 MediaTailor SSAI 문제 해결.
모범 사례
SSAI를 채널 어셈블리와 성공적으로 통합하려면 다음 모범 사례를 따르세요.
-
철저한 테스트: 프로덕션에 배포하기 전에 다양한 콘텐츠 유형, 광고 시나리오 및 최종 사용자 조건으로 통합 솔루션을 테스트합니다.
-
지속적으로 모니터링: 발생하는 문제를 신속하게 식별하고 해결할 수 있도록 포괄적인 모니터링 및 알림을 설정합니다.
-
캐싱 최적화: 실제 사용 패턴 및 성능 지표를 기반으로 CDN 캐싱 설정을 정기적으로 검토하고 조정합니다.
-
규모 조정 계획: 특히 인기 있는 채널 또는 이벤트의 경우 피크 트래픽 로드를 처리하도록 아키텍처를 설계합니다.
-
중복성 고려: 중요한 구성 요소에 중복성을 구현하여 선형 채널의 고가용성을 보장합니다.
-
광고 전환 최적화: 일관된 인코딩 프로필과 세그먼트 기간을 사용하여 콘텐츠와 광고 간의 원활한 전환을 보장합니다.
관련 정보
SSAI를 채널 어셈블리와 통합하는 방법에 대한 자세한 내용은 다음을 참조하세요.
- 채널 어셈블리 설명서
-
AWS Elemental MediaTailor 를 사용하여 선형 어셈블 스트림 생성 - 채널 어셈블리 개념에 대해 알아봅니다.
CDN을 사용한 채널 어셈블리 - CDN을 사용하여 채널 어셈블리 설정
- SSAI 설명서
-
CDN을 사용한 광고 삽입 - CDN을 사용하여 광고 삽입 설정
CDN 및 MediaTailor 통합을 위한 광고 삽입 아키텍처 이해 - 광고 삽입 CDN 아키텍처 이해
- CDN 구성
-
CDN 통합 설정 - 일반 CDN 구성 지침
CloudFront 통합 - CloudFront 특정 구성